Transaction 32799a98d27e03b4be12cfebf59bf074570ea6ce68269223ce106d0f03bd33d7

21 Input
1 Outputs
  • 32799a98d27e03b4be12cfebf59bf074570ea6ce68269223ce106d0f03bd33d7:0
  • value  4734520
    address  32TaKQ92gWm17EJYLGBA7sE2wUg6KpVqQx